    This terraced freehold property on Freehold Street last sold in October 2004 for £64,000. Based on price growth in the HU3 district since then, its estimated current value is £195,075 — placing it in the 23rd percentile nationally and the 90th percentile within HU3. The property covers 85 m² (915 sq ft), giving an estimated value of £2,295 per m². The EPC rating is D, with a potential rating of B.
